Subject: [PATCH 4/5] ocxl: Add functions to map/unmap LPC memory
Date: Tue, 17 Sep 2019 11:43:00 +1000	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20190917014307.30485-5-alastair@au1.ibm.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20190917014307.30485-1-alastair@au1.ibm.com>

From: Alastair D'Silva <alastair@d-silva.org>

Add functions to map/unmap LPC memory

Signed-off-by: Alastair D'Silva <alastair@d-silva.org>
---
 drivers/misc/ocxl/config.c        |  4 +++
 drivers/misc/ocxl/core.c          | 50 +++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++
 drivers/misc/ocxl/link.c          |  4 +--
 drivers/misc/ocxl/ocxl_internal.h | 10 +++++--
 include/misc/ocxl.h               | 18 +++++++++++
 5 files changed, 82 insertions(+), 4 deletions(-)

diff --git a/drivers/misc/ocxl/config.c b/drivers/misc/ocxl/config.c
index c8e19bfb5ef9..fb0c3b6f8312 100644
--- a/drivers/misc/ocxl/config.c
+++ b/drivers/misc/ocxl/config.c
@@ -568,6 +568,10 @@ static int read_afu_lpc_memory_info(struct pci_dev *dev,
 		afu->special_purpose_mem_size =
 			total_mem_size - lpc_mem_size;
 	}
+
+	dev_info(&dev->dev, "Probed LPC memory of %#llx bytes and special purpose memory of %#llx bytes\n",
+		afu->lpc_mem_size, afu->special_purpose_mem_size);
+
 	return 0;
 }
 
diff --git a/drivers/misc/ocxl/core.c b/drivers/misc/ocxl/core.c
index fdfe4e0a34e1..eb24bb9d655f 100644
--- a/drivers/misc/ocxl/core.c
+++ b/drivers/misc/ocxl/core.c
@@ -210,6 +210,55 @@ static void unmap_mmio_areas(struct ocxl_afu *afu)
 	release_fn_bar(afu->fn, afu->config.global_mmio_bar);
 }
 
+int ocxl_map_lpc_mem(struct ocxl_afu *afu)
+{
+	struct pci_dev *dev = to_pci_dev(afu->fn->dev.parent);
+
+	if ((afu->config.lpc_mem_size + afu->config.special_purpose_mem_size) == 0)
+		return 0;
+
+	afu->lpc_base_addr = ocxl_link_lpc_online(afu->fn->link, dev);
+	if (afu->lpc_base_addr == 0)
+		return -EINVAL;
+
+	if (afu->config.lpc_mem_size) {
+		afu->lpc_res.start = afu->lpc_base_addr + afu->config.lpc_mem_offset;
+		afu->lpc_res.end = afu->lpc_res.start + afu->config.lpc_mem_size - 1;
+	}
+
+	if (afu->config.special_purpose_mem_size) {
+		afu->special_purpose_res.start = afu->lpc_base_addr +
+						 afu->config.special_purpose_mem_offset;
+		afu->special_purpose_res.end = afu->special_purpose_res.start +
+					       afu->config.special_purpose_mem_size - 1;
+	}
+
+	return 0;
+}
+EXPORT_SYMBOL(ocxl_map_lpc_mem);
+
+struct resource *ocxl_afu_lpc_mem(struct ocxl_afu *afu)
+{
+	return &afu->lpc_res;
+}
+EXPORT_SYMBOL(ocxl_afu_lpc_mem);
+
+static void unmap_lpc_mem(struct ocxl_afu *afu)
+{
+	struct pci_dev *dev = to_pci_dev(afu->fn->dev.parent);
+
+	if (afu->lpc_res.start || afu->special_purpose_res.start) {
+		void *link = afu->fn->link;
+
+		ocxl_link_lpc_offline(link, dev);
+
+		afu->lpc_res.start = 0;
+		afu->lpc_res.end = 0;
+		afu->special_purpose_res.start = 0;
+		afu->special_purpose_res.end = 0;
+	}
+}
+
 static int configure_afu(struct ocxl_afu *afu, u8 afu_idx, struct pci_dev *dev)
 {
 	int rc;
@@ -250,6 +299,7 @@ static int configure_afu(struct ocxl_afu *afu, u8 afu_idx, struct pci_dev *dev)
 
 static void deconfigure_afu(struct ocxl_afu *afu)
 {
+	unmap_lpc_mem(afu);
 	unmap_mmio_areas(afu);
 	reclaim_afu_pasid(afu);
 	reclaim_afu_actag(afu);
diff --git a/drivers/misc/ocxl/link.c b/drivers/misc/ocxl/link.c
index 2874811a4398..9e303a5f4d85 100644
--- a/drivers/misc/ocxl/link.c
+++ b/drivers/misc/ocxl/link.c
@@ -738,7 +738,7 @@ int ocxl_link_add_lpc_mem(void *link_handle, u64 size)
 }
 EXPORT_SYMBOL_GPL(ocxl_link_add_lpc_mem);
 
-u64 ocxl_link_lpc_map(void *link_handle, struct pci_dev *pdev)
+u64 ocxl_link_lpc_online(void *link_handle, struct pci_dev *pdev)
 {
 	struct ocxl_link *link = (struct ocxl_link *) link_handle;
 
@@ -759,7 +759,7 @@ u64 ocxl_link_lpc_map(void *link_handle, struct pci_dev *pdev)
 	return link->lpc_mem;
 }
 
-void ocxl_link_lpc_release(void *link_handle, struct pci_dev *pdev)
+void ocxl_link_lpc_offline(void *link_handle, struct pci_dev *pdev)
 {
 	struct ocxl_link *link = (struct ocxl_link *) link_handle;
 
diff --git a/drivers/misc/ocxl/ocxl_internal.h b/drivers/misc/ocxl/ocxl_internal.h
index db2647a90fc8..5656a4aab5b7 100644
--- a/drivers/misc/ocxl/ocxl_internal.h
+++ b/drivers/misc/ocxl/ocxl_internal.h
@@ -52,6 +52,12 @@ struct ocxl_afu {
 	void __iomem *global_mmio_ptr;
 	u64 pp_mmio_start;
 	void *private;
+	u64 lpc_base_addr; /* Covers both LPC & special purpose memory */
+	struct bin_attribute attr_global_mmio;
+	struct bin_attribute attr_lpc_mem;
+	struct resource lpc_res;
+	struct bin_attribute attr_special_purpose_mem;
+	struct resource special_purpose_res;
 };
 
 enum ocxl_context_status {
@@ -170,7 +176,7 @@ extern u64 ocxl_link_get_lpc_mem_sz(void *link_handle);
  * @link_handle: The OpenCAPI link handle
  * @pdev: A device that is on the link
  */
-u64 ocxl_link_lpc_map(void *link_handle, struct pci_dev *pdev);
+u64 ocxl_link_lpc_online(void *link_handle, struct pci_dev *pdev);
 
 /**
  * Release the LPC memory device for an OpenCAPI device
@@ -181,6 +187,6 @@ u64 ocxl_link_lpc_map(void *link_handle, struct pci_dev *pdev);
  * @link_handle: The OpenCAPI link handle
  * @pdev: A device that is on the link
  */
-void ocxl_link_lpc_release(void *link_handle, struct pci_dev *pdev);
+void ocxl_link_lpc_offline(void *link_handle, struct pci_dev *pdev);
 
 #endif /* _OCXL_INTERNAL_H_ */
diff --git a/include/misc/ocxl.h b/include/misc/ocxl.h
index 06dd5839e438..a1897737908d 100644
--- a/include/misc/ocxl.h
+++ b/include/misc/ocxl.h
@@ -212,6 +212,24 @@ int ocxl_irq_set_handler(struct ocxl_context *ctx, int irq_id,
 
 // AFU Metadata
 
+/**
+ * Map the LPC system & special purpose memory for an AFU
+ *
+ * Do not call this during device discovery, as there may me multiple
+ * devices on a link, and the memory is mapped for the whole link, not
+ * just one device. It should only be called after all devices have
+ * registered their memory on the link.
+ *
+ * afu: The AFU that has the LPC memory to map
+ */
+extern int ocxl_map_lpc_mem(struct ocxl_afu *afu);
+
+/**
+ * Get the physical address range of LPC memory for an AFU
+ * afu: The AFU associated with the LPC memory
+ */
+extern struct resource *ocxl_afu_lpc_mem(struct ocxl_afu *afu);
+
 /**
  * Get a pointer to the config for an AFU
  *
